Automation Pipelines: A Growing Challenge
Test automation pipelines are now critical to modern software development processes, which often rely on continuous integration (CI) and continuous delivery (CD) frameworks. However, this progress has introduced several challenges:
- Rising Test Volume: Expanding systems lead to exponentially increasing test cases, requiring smarter execution processes.
- Diverse Testing Needs: Platforms like web, mobile, and IoT demand versatile testing approaches.
- Frequent Updates: Agile and DevOps practices accelerate development cycles, rendering manual strategies obsolete.
- Tool Integration: Seamlessly combining tools for requirements, testing, monitoring, and deployment is a growing obstacle.
AI-Driven Enhancements in Test Execution
AI is transforming the traditionally static approaches to test automation by offering dynamic, predictive, and adaptive solutions:
- Smart Test Selection: Machine learning algorithms pinpoint essential test cases, cutting unnecessary effort without sacrificing quality.
- Automated Failure Analysis: AI can identify root causes of failures quickly and recommend fixes, speeding up debugging processes.
- Self-Healing Tests: AI-enabled scripts automatically adapt to minor changes, eliminating flakiness and reducing maintenance.
- Anomaly Detection: AI detects irregular test patterns, preemptively identifying problems during deployment.
- Resource Optimization: By dynamically managing testing environments, AI reduces execution time and cost.

Trends to Expect by 2025
As AI’s role in test automation continues to grow, the following trends will redefine the software industry:
- AI and DevOps Collaboration: AI increasingly integrates and aids decision-making in the DevOps lifecycle.
- Comprehensive Monitoring: Machine learning systems will track performance across CI/CD pipelines.
- Explainable AI Solutions: Teams will demand insights into AI’s decision rationale, ensuring alignment.
- Earlier Testing Phases: AI facilitates defect prevention as early as the coding stage.
- Business-Oriented Testing: Testing outcomes will be tied to tangible business goals like user satisfaction or revenue.
